• Shop by category
  • Powered by eBay
  • 2005 Mitsubishi Endeavor 4WD engine computer control module ecu ecm pcu pcm oem

    • Item No : 254835869583
    • Condition : Used
    • Brand : Mitsubishi
    • Seller : pickapartoregon
    • Current Bid : US $149.95
    • * Item Description

    • 2005 Mitsubishi Endeavor engine computer part ID 1860A060. stk 3y1299. loc w5i06b.
    ★ Recommended Products Related To This Item
    ♥ Best Selling Products in this category